Abstract
The utility model provides a kind of male end conducting rod and water-proof connector, belongs to connection terminal field, wherein male end conducting rod, including the first male end bar and the second male end bar;First male end bar includes the first end being oppositely arranged and the second end, the second end are provided with the first connector;Second male end bar includes the 3rd end and the 4th end being oppositely arranged, and the 4th end is provided with the second connector;First connector is more enough to be coordinated with the second connector so that the first male end bar and the circumferentially spacing connection of the second male end bar.Can be with adjustment length by male end conducting rod, while it is also convenient for transport storage.Water-proof connector includes waterproof case, male end conducting rod and female end conducting rod, and male end conducting rod and female end conducting rod are contained in waterproof case to complete connection.

Embodiment one
A kind of water-proof connector 001 is present embodiments provided, referring to Fig. 1, this water-proof connector 001 is led including male end
Electric pole 010, female end conducting rod 030 and waterproof case.
Fig. 2 and Fig. 3 are referred to, wherein male end conducting rod 010 includes the first male end bar 100 and the second male end bar 200.
Fig. 4 and Fig. 5 are referred to, the first male end bar 100 is solid cylindrical rod, and in the present embodiment, the first male end bar 100 makes
It is made of copper, there is good electric conductivity, and intensity and wearability can meet the requirement of connector.
First male end bar 100 includes the end 130 of first end 110 and second being oppositely arranged, and the second end 130 is provided with first
Connector 150.First connector 150 is integrally formed with the first male end bar 100, ensures the first connector 150 and the in connection
One male end bar 100 is not easily disconnected from.
In the present embodiment, the first connector 150 is that three inserted links are first inserted link 151 and two second inserted links
153.Three inserted links are cylindrical bar, and the first inserted link 151 and the first male end bar 100 are coaxial, the inserted link of the first inserted link 151 to the second
153 is thick, has the intensity higher than the second inserted link 153.Pass through the first inserted link 151, it is ensured that the first connector 150 and first
When perpendicular to the power of axial direction, the junction of the first inserted link 151 and the first male end bar 100 is not easily broken to cause point male end bar 100
From.
Two the second inserted links 153 are symmetrically positioned in the both sides of the first inserted link 151, and the inserted link 151 of the second inserted link 153 to the first is thin,
When the first male end bar 100 and the second male end bar 200 connect, primarily serve and avoid the first male end bar 100 and the second male end bar 200
The effect of relative rotation.
Fig. 6 and Fig. 7 are referred to, the second male end bar 200 is solid with the diameter identical of the radial section of the first male end bar 100
Cylindrical bar, in the present embodiment, the second male end bar 200 make to be made of copper, and have good electric conductivity, and intensity and wearability
The requirement of connector can be met.
Second male end bar 200 includes the 3rd end 210 and the 4th end 230 being oppositely arranged, and the 4th end 230 is provided with second
Connector 250, the second connector 250 are the first slot 251 and the second slot 253 coordinated with the first connector 150.
The major diameter fit of the internal diameter of first slot 251 and the first inserted link 151, the first inserted link 151 is inserted into the first slot 251
Afterwards, the second male end bar 200 can only rotate relative to the first male end bar 100, and axially adjacent to or away from the first male end bar 100.
The major diameter fit of the internal diameter of second slot 253 and the second inserted link 153, two the second inserted links 153 are inserted accordingly
After two the second slots 253, you can so that the first male end bar 100 and the circumferential spacing connection of the second male end bar 200, i.e. the first male end
Bar 100 can not rotate relative to the second male end bar 200.In the present embodiment, only set at the 4th end 230 of the second male end bar 200
Have two the second slots 253, in other cases, can also set four, six or other cause the first male end bar 100 and
It can be attached between two male end bars 200 under different angular compliances.
The first end 110 of first male end bar 100 is provided with the first breach 170, the first breach 170 has smooth wall,
The first male end bar 100 is facilitated to insert in the hole of female end by the first breach 170.And first breach 170 can also be used as wire
Tie point so that wire can be fixed between the wall of breach and mounting hole.And flexibly it is oriented to by smooth wall slotting
Direction is pulled out, improves the plug of male end conducting rod 010, in specific experiment, there is the male end conducting rod of the first breach 170
010 plug number can reach more than 2000 times.
The second breach 270 is provided with the 3rd end 210 of the second male end bar 200, the second breach 270 has smooth wall,
The first male end bar 100 can be also facilitated to insert in the hole of female end by the second breach 270.And second breach 270 can also conduct
The tie point of wire so that wire can be fixed between the wall of breach and mounting hole.
First breach 170 and the second breach 270 are symmetrical arranged so that the first male end bar 100 and the second male end bar 200 connect
Connecing the male end conducting rod 010 after coordinating has the speciality of the both ends same sex, is user-friendly for coordinating in actual use,
Direction is avoided to re-start the situation of cooperation using mistake.
First connector 150 can be not only the inserted link of three cylinders, quantity can also be two, four or other, only
The first male end bar 100 can be avoided and the second male end bar 200 can coordinate again after can not mutually rotate easily;Shape
Can be not only cylinder, or hexagon, special-shaped bar or other, as long as the first male end bar 100 and the can be avoided
Two male end bars 200 can not be rotated mutually easily after can coordinating again.
Fig. 8 and Fig. 9 are referred to, female end conducting rod 030 includes conductive bar body 300, and conductive bar body 300 is hollow stem copper
Bar processed, is provided with the installation through-hole 310 coaxial with conductive bar body 300 in conductive bar body 300, installation through-hole 310 it is interior
Wall is smooth, ensure that the durability of female end conducting rod 030, and avoids the damage to male end conducting rod 010.
In the present embodiment, installation through-hole 310 is cylindrical hole so that the radial section of conductive bar body 300 is annular.
Female end conducting rod 030 includes the 5th end 330 and the 6th end 350 being oppositely arranged.The 5th of conductive bar body 300 the
End 330 is provided with closing in 370.Elastic seam 371 is provided with 370 closing up, in the present embodiment, elastic seam 371 has two, and two
With in one plane, this plane is symmetrical arranged individual elastic seam 371 by the axle center of conductive bar body 300, i.e., elastic seam 371
The both sides of the axial line of conductive bar body 300.
Elastic seam 371 extends from the end at the 5th end 330 to the 6th end 350, and is closed in one end close to the 6th end 350
Close, by two it is elastic seam 371 cooperation female end conducting rod 030 closing in 370 can appropriate folding, when male end conducting rod
Can suitably it be unclamped during 010 end 210 of first end 110 or the 3rd insertion closing in 370 so that the termination of male end conducting rod 010 is inserted
Entering, the clamping force male end conducting rod 010 and female end conducting rod 030 on the other hand provided by elastic seam 371 closely connects,
Male end is improved to female end or female end to the electric conductivity of male end.
5th end 330 of female end conducting rod 030 and the 6th end 350 are provided with edging 390, avoid female end conducting rod 030
Charge concentration, improve the proof voltage energy of female end conducting rod 030, extend the service life of female end conducting rod 030.And edging
After 390 the 5th end 330 and the 6th end 350 can ensure that female end conducting rod 030 is installed in road waterproof case, waterproof will not be damaged
Housing causes water resistance to fail.
6th end 350 of female end conducting rod 030 can be also used for the connection of conductive the end of a thread, and conductive the end of a thread can be from the 6th end
350 insertions, to complete male end to the path of female end.Multiple pore solidus parts can also be inserted with the 6th end 350 simultaneously,
Wire is inserted in pore, improves the connective stability of wire and female end conducting rod 030.
Waterproof case includes the first housing 410 and the second housing 430, and male end conducting rod 010 is arranged on the first housing 410
Interior, female end conducting rod 030 is arranged in the second housing 430, can by the first housing 410 and the second the close to each other of housing 430
To cause in one end of male end conducting rod 010 insertion female end conducting rod 030 so as to complete to connect.
Male end conducting rod 010 provided by the utility model, product can be ensured more preferably by solid hopkinson bar made of copper design
Electric conductivity, ensured by way of the first connector 150 and the connection of the second connector 250 under the conditions of same component assembly
The entire length of the first male end bar 100 and the second male end bar 200 can be adjusted to ensure to contact effect.Transported simultaneously in part
Also there is the advantage for accounting for smaller storage area, on the one hand the setting of the first breach 170 and the second breach 270 ensure that male end in journey
The both ends same sex of conducting rod 010, and cause male end conducting rod 010 more preferably plug property and resistance to plug.
Female end conducting rod 030 provided by the utility model, male end conducting rod 010 and female end can be ensured by closing in 370
The contact effect of conducting rod 030, and the design of elastic seam 371 can facilitate the insertion of male end while ensureing to contact effect,
And improve service life.Edging 390 at the 5th end 330 and the 6th end 350 can avoid charge concentration from improving service life,
And avoid cutting waterproof case, improve insulation effect.
Water-proof connector 001 provided by the utility model, male end conducting rod 010 and female end can be completed by waterproof case
The connection of conducting rod 030, so as to ensure electric conductivity and water resistance.
